From the energy security perspective, which of the following energy sources is considered most secure for India?
Solar
Energy security is vital for any nation. It refers to the uninterrupted availability of energy sources at an affordable price. For a country like India, which has a large and growing energy demand, ensuring energy security means relying on sources that are reliable, domestically available, and less susceptible to global price volatility or geopolitical issues.
We need to evaluate the given energy sources from the perspective of India's energy security.
Geothermal energy taps into the Earth's heat. While it is a renewable and constant source where available, India's geothermal potential is concentrated in specific regions and is not as widespread or easily exploitable on a large scale compared to other renewable sources like solar or wind. Its limited geographical distribution makes it less significant for overall national energy security compared to sources available across the country.
Hydroelectric power is generated from the energy of moving water. India has significant hydro resources, especially in the Himalayan region and other parts of the country. However, large hydro projects can face challenges related to environmental impact, displacement of communities, and dependence on rainfall patterns (monsoon variability). Also, the best sites are often in specific, sometimes remote, locations, and transmission over long distances is required. These factors can introduce vulnerabilities from an energy security standpoint.
Wind energy harnesses wind power, primarily through turbines located in areas with consistent strong winds, like coastal regions and certain plains. India has substantial wind power capacity. However, wind energy is intermittent; it only generates power when the wind blows at a suitable speed. This intermittency requires sophisticated grid management, energy storage solutions, or backup power sources, which can pose challenges to grid stability and reliable supply without complementary technologies.
Solar energy converts sunlight directly into electricity using photovoltaic panels or concentrates sunlight to generate heat. India receives abundant sunlight throughout the year across most of its geographical area. From an energy security perspective, solar energy offers several key advantages for India:
Considering the criteria of energy security – availability, reliability, affordability, and independence from external factors – solar energy stands out for India. Its widespread availability across the country, potential for distributed generation, and independence from fuel imports make it a highly secure energy source for India's future.
| Energy Source | Key Characteristics for India | Energy Security Perspective |
|---|---|---|
| Geothermal | Heat from Earth's interior; location-specific. | Limited potential compared to others; not widespread for national security impact. |
| Hydro | Water power; site-specific; dependent on monsoon; environmental concerns. | Vulnerable to rainfall variability; large projects can face social/environmental hurdles; transmission challenges. |
| Solar | Sunlight; widespread availability; modular technology. | Abundant domestic resource; low import dependence; supports distributed generation; high security. |
| Wind | Wind power; site-specific (windy areas); intermittent. | Availability depends on wind; requires grid balancing and storage; location-dependent. |
The Indian government has aggressively promoted solar energy through policies, incentives, and large-scale projects. Initiatives like the National Solar Mission have aimed to significantly increase solar power capacity. The development of solar parks, rooftop solar schemes, and focus on solar manufacturing are all part of India's strategy to leverage solar energy not just for clean power but also for enhanced energy security and self-reliance.
